Granting summary decision is a judicial ruling made by a court without a full trial, typically when there is no genuine dispute as to the material facts of the case.
Either party involved in a legal dispute may file for a granting summary decision.
To fill out a granting summary decision, parties must provide relevant facts, legal arguments, and supporting evidence.
The purpose of granting summary decision is to resolve legal disputes efficiently and fairly without the need for a lengthy trial.
The granting summary decision must include a summary of the facts, legal reasoning, and the court's ruling.
